How are timesheets created?
In both Classic list page and MUX if a timesheet shows as open, it does not necessarily mean a timesheet has already been created. Timesheets actually get created when an entry appears in the prtimesheet table.
Here are other ways (besides clicking on Create Timesheet or the timesheet icon) to create timesheets.
Example 1: In classic you are able to submit a timesheet by clicking on the checkbox on the list page and clicking submit. This will create the timesheet in the prtimesheet table.
Example 2: In MUX, on the timesheets grid filter for Open Timesheets (normally these have not been actually created and in the prtimesheet table either).
- Click on one of the rows. This will actually create the timesheet in the prtimesheet table.
What updates the Updated By on the timesheet?
When the timesheet is created, either by the user when filling in their time, or either of the Examples above the Updated By will show this person.
Other ways the Updated By can change is when a specific action is made on the timesheet.
These include:
Editing a timesheet that has already been created
Submitting a timesheet
Approving a timesheet
Returning a timesheet
Post Timesheet job will update the field to the user who actual ran the Post Timesheet Job.
